summ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orNicolai Hähnle <[email protected]>2018-12-06 12:43:44 +0100
committerMarek Olšák <[email protected]>2019-06-12 20:28:23 -0400
commit16bee0e5f6a70e959be27c253c4be130bb034030 (patch)
tree85c01976c8794b05c4c889ecdea3487d730865be
parent3c958d924ae291b1793c200b85d4d7a991c0fa97 (diff)
radeonsi: don't declare pointers to static strings
The compiler should be able to optimize them away, but still. There's no point in declaring those as pointers, and if the compiler *doesn't* optimize them away, they add unnecessary load-time relocations. Reviewed-by: Marek Olšák <[email protected]>
-rw-r--r--src/gallium/drivers/radeonsi/si_shader.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/gallium/drivers/radeonsi/si_shader.c b/src/gallium/drivers/radeonsi/si_shader.c
index 21b2819c857..ad965a11750 100644
--- a/src/gallium/drivers/radeonsi/si_shader.c
+++ b/src/gallium/drivers/radeonsi/si_shader.c
@@ -38,10 +38,10 @@
#include "compiler/nir/nir.h"
-static const char *scratch_rsrc_dword0_symbol =
+static const char scratch_rsrc_dword0_symbol[] =
"SCRATCH_RSRC_DWORD0";
-static const char *scratch_rsrc_dword1_symbol =
+static const char scratch_rsrc_dword1_symbol[] =
"SCRATCH_RSRC_DWORD1";
struct si_shader_output_values